The Greater Atlantic Region Commercial Fishing Business Cost Survey for calendar year 2022 is now open for participation.

This is a voluntary survey, collecting commercial fishing business cost information from federally permitted vessel owners.  All owners of federally-permitted commercial fishing vessels that were active in either 2021 or 2022 may participate.

The survey was last conducted in 2016. This information is used to track trends in costs over time, assess economic fishery performance, and ultimately inform management decisions. This survey is the only NOAA Fisheries effort collecting this type of cost information in our region. 

Cost information can only be used to inform management decisions with participation from industry members.

The survey is being administered by NOAA’s Social Sciences Branch in partnership with the survey firm ICF.
